Woody Wilson Invite
Friday, April 16th, 2004 @ UC Davis
Elite marks all around!

Calvin Glass (Woodcreek) fine 1:54.26 - 4:18.92 double! - Kelly McGrath (Jesuit) 15-00 PV
Aaron Tombleson (Woodland) 58-7; 170-7 Weight double - Fairfield sweeps girls 4x100-4x200-4x400
Lauren Mulkey (Woodcreek) 2:14.62 - 4:53.89 double - Rachel Bryan (Laguna Creek) 10:42.36 3200

Russell Cup (SS)
Saturday, April 17, 2004 @ Carpinteria HS
Small Schools standouts take center stage!

St. Joseph (Santa Maria) Boys & Oak Park Girls take Sweeps Titles
George Morris (St. Bonaventure) 4:24.08 B1600 - Kurt Boehm (Paraclete) 14-06 BPV MR -
Vache Sevajian (Maranatha) BSP 56-03 1/4 - Kyle Hammerquist-Davis BDT 176-08 MR
Juliette Martinez (Fillmore) 12.29-25.52-58.26 sprint triple (100-200 MR's) - Star is Born?

Hampton-Phillips Invitational (CCS) - Updated 4/19
Saturday, April 17th, 2004 @ San Jose CC
Fast winds = hot dash times!

 
Photos by Margaret Gallagher
Milpitas senior Erinn Kim (11:07.69) and Monta Vista freshman Lisa Worsham
were among the top placers in the girls' 3200-meter run at Hampton-Phillips!

Wopamo Osaisai (Pinole Valley) 10.59w B100m (+5.1 mps) and 21.76 200m nwi;
Kevin Craddock (Logan, Union City) 54.75 400m IH;
Nkosinza Balumbu (James Logan) 49-11w, Angelo Jeffery (James Logan) 48-0 (legal wind);
Brittany Daniels (Merrill West) 19-00.75 LJ (wind legal) - 41-06.75 TJ (wind legal)
Jennifer Nash (Merrill West, Tracy) 11.66w G100m +2.5 - West 47.12 G400 Re
Alicia Follmar (Saratoga) 2:12.10 G800-4:52.57 G1600 - Talia Stewart 62.23 G400H & 56.69 G400
Angelique Smith (Logan) 23.71 G200 nwi - Evelyn Wing (Valley Christian) 2:13.35 G800 in 2nd

Weekend Reports - 4/17/04
Chock: 4.34.65 for 1500m!

Caitlin Chock (Unat/Granite Bay HS) 4:34.65 (#2 mark in U.S. behind Nicole Blood)
to win College/Open 1500 at the Woody Wilson Invitational at UC Davis on 4/17
